RHEL 9 file system automount function must be disabled unless required.

STIG ID: RHEL-09-231040  |  SRG: SRG-OS-000114-GPOS-00059 | Severity: medium |  CCI: CCI-000366,CCI-000778,CCI-001958

Check

Verify that RHEL 9 file system automount function has been disabled with the following command:

$ sudo systemctl is-enabled autofs

masked

If the returned value is not "masked", "disabled", "Failed to get unit file state for autofs.service for autofs", or "enabled", and is not documented as operational requirement with the information system security officer ISSO, this is a finding.

Fix

Configure RHEL 9 to disable the ability to automount devices.

The autofs service can be disabled with the following command:

$ sudo systemctl mask --now autofs.service
